**Core Concept**
The question tests the ability to differentiate between various types of tumors, focusing on those that originate from neuronal tissue. **Neuronal tumors** arise from cells that are part of the nervous system, including neurons and their supporting cells. Understanding the classification and characteristics of these tumors is crucial for diagnosis and treatment.

For example, tumors like **meningiomas** originate from the meninges, the protective layers of tissue covering the brain and spinal cord, and are not considered neuronal tumors.
